The Federal Maritime Commission (FMC) isn’t just watching anymore: they’re swinging the hammer. With record-breaking penalties totaling over $68 million in early 2026, the era of "billing mistakes happen" is officially over for 3PLs and carriers alike.

The OSRA Hammer is Falling

The surge stems from the Ocean Shipping Reform Act (OSRA) and a more aggressive Bureau of Enforcement. The FMC is now proactively hunting for detention and demurrage (D&D) violations rather than waiting for private complaints. A January 2026 precedential order clarified that repeated billing errors, even if unintentional, are now considered unlawful practices. For a 3PL Maryland provider or an NVOCC, a messy invoice is no longer just a clerical error; it’s a high-stakes federal liability.

Accuracy is the New Speed

This means your carrier choice directly determines your risk profile. If your partners aren't auditing their tariffs daily, you’re exposed. Under 46 U.S.C. § 40501, every day a tariff remains inaccurate or ambiguous can be treated as a separate violation.
